Burnham ladies and mixed touch squad rocked up in force for the Essex 02 touch Festival at Upminster. It was a blisteringly hot day with music blaring out so out ran our squad against the giants of Havering and Upminster. Although it was our first official fixture as our mixed squad we were not put off by the apparent experience and speed of the opposition. We put up a tremendous fight with some excellent defence work. Most matches ending in either a draw or just one or two points in it. Our fast feet also threw the opposition as our top try scorer Lewis Gillett was fed some fantastic ball and was superb in finishing off the try and scoring several times through his clever dummies. Our squad had the most “ladies” in it and boy did they know how to play with their experience they worked well together to make some tremendous ground. The whole team were excellent and never let themselves down with even the youngest of the squad Joe Banks still putting pressure on right to the last minute. It was a great afternoon and we were awarded the Plate winners and Lewis Gillett was voted the overall youth player of the festival!
